以文本方式查看主题

-  Foxtable(狐表)  (http://www.foxtable.com/bbs/index.asp)
--  专家坐堂  (http://www.foxtable.com/bbs/list.asp?boardid=2)
----  不同表自动获取一个表列的内容  (http://www.foxtable.com/bbs/dispbbs.asp?boardid=2&id=12114)

--  作者:ruan
--  发布时间:2011/8/23 16:54:00
--  不同表自动获取一个表列的内容
两个不同表的列同步使用跨表引用已经实现,但跨表引用不能自动获取添加的内容  修改了后不同步 要手动添加才更新数据。要怎么实现从A表录入数据 B表自动获取 不需要再手动添加。 A表修改内容B表自动更新。A表添加B表也跟着自己添加。
[此贴子已经被作者于2011-8-23 16:55:09编辑过]

--  作者:狐狸爸爸
--  发布时间:2011/8/23 17:07:00
--  

跨表引用实现自动更新很容易。

你说的自动增加,我不明白,能否具体点。

提问最好配合简单的示例文件,这样可以更快地获得帮助。


--  作者:ruan
--  发布时间:2011/8/23 17:24:00
--  

 比如说 产品表 产品明细表 里面都有 规格 型号 编号 列 当我在产品表添加新的产品时 产品明细表的规格 型号 编号 .. 自动添加 。就是两个表的 列是完全同步的 一个表更新 另一个表也更新 一个表添加或删除另一个表也更着添加或删除。


--  作者:狐狸爸爸
--  发布时间:2011/8/23 17:51:00
--  

是自动更新,不是自动添加吧?

 

表之间数据引用有两种方式:

 

1、用关联和表达式,建议看看帮助:使用指南- 关联表 和 使用指南 - 表达式  这两章

2、或者用代码:

http://www.foxtable.com/help/topics/1451.htm

http://www.foxtable.com/help/topics/1453.htm

 

如果我理解错误,自己做个简单的示例文件传上来,说明问题所在。

 


--  作者:ruan
--  发布时间:2011/8/23 18:15:00
--  
 
一个产品表 一个产品明细表 我在产品表添加记录 产品明细表同步添加  使用跨表引用我在第一个表添加记录第二个表不会添加新的记录
以下是引用狐狸爸爸在2011-8-23 17:51:00的发言:

是自动更新,不是自动添加吧?

 

表之间数据引用有两种方式:

 

1、用关联和表达式,建议看看帮助:使用指南- 关联表 和 使用指南 - 表达式  这两章

2、或者用代码:

http://www.foxtable.com/help/topics/1451.htm

http://www.foxtable.com/help/topics/1453.htm

 

如果我理解错误,自己做个简单的示例文件传上来,说明问题所在。

 


图片点击可在新窗口打开查看此主题相关图片如下:cp.png
图片点击可在新窗口打开查看

图片点击可在新窗口打开查看此主题相关图片如下:cpmx.png
图片点击可在新窗口打开查看

 下载信息  [文件大小:   下载次数: ]
图片点击可在新窗口打开查看点击浏览该文件:列同步.rar

 

 

 

一个产品表 一个产品明细表 我在产品表添加记录 产品明细表同步添加  使用跨表引用我在第一个表添加记录第二个表不会添加新的记录


 

[此贴子已经被作者于2011-8-23 18:17:54编辑过]

--  作者:狐狸爸爸
--  发布时间:2011/8/23 21:34:00
--  

这个满足你的要求,产品表新增一行,输入生产号,产品明细表就会自动增加一行,修改产品表的数据,产品明细表相关列的数据也会自动更新。

 

 下载信息  [文件大小:   下载次数: ]
图片点击可在新窗口打开查看点击浏览该文件:管理项目1.rar

 

对于初学者,自动增加行搞不定是应该的,但是关联和表达式应该有所掌握了。

 

建议您细看帮助文件,从使用指南这部分开始看,使用熟悉了,再看开发部分。

 

学习过程遇到问题,可随时上来提问。

[此贴子已经被作者于2011-8-23 21:35:32编辑过]